Well, I'm not sure what my opinion on the value of the Canadian dollar being so high is.

I live in Sault Ste Marie, a border town. So, to get some cheap goods (gas, milk, tools...etc.) its a lot cheaper to cross the bridge to the States to get it. A good thing.

However, every time I do that, I'm putting some poor Canadian slob out of a job. A bad thing.

But in this town, the effects could be severe. This is a "steel town". If no international companies want to buy our steel because it's too expensive...lots of people will loose their jobs. A very bad thing.

Besides the steel plant, we also seem to have an over abundance of call centres here in town. People I know are already losing their jobs because it is much cheaper now for the call centres to be in India.
